Output f8ca1553d1e9000942019208c76ffce97651426e97838767dbafd04dca0018f0:2

value
1560000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b74440309af209207f10a26c0bd491840172a48 OP_EQUAL
address
3JnBZhMK4Jm94Y4XoFPGXAgvTrcVnaYm2F
transaction
f8ca1553d1e9000942019208c76ffce97651426e97838767dbafd04dca0018f0
spent
true